How they compare
Luxembourg currently reports 8,439 1000 SLC against 4,372 1000 SLC in Malta, a difference of 4,067 1000 SLC.
That makes Luxembourg's figure about 1.9 times Malta's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Malta ahead.
Luxembourg ranks 118th and Malta ranks 120th of 127 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Luxembourg averaged higher in 2 and Malta in 1.

About this data
The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
